Chloe flips a fair coin 2 times. What is the probability that she will flip tails both times?

Answer:

25%

Explanation:

If you flip a coin twice, sometimes you get tails twice in a row. That is because each time you flip the coin, the odds remain 1/2; the two flips are independent of each other. The odds of getting tails twice in a row are 1/2 * 1/2 = 1/4. So 25% of the time you'll get heads twice in a row
